Phalanx Drop Sting, 6-5
|
The Philadelphia Phalanx knocked off the Seattle Sting, 6-5, in Federal League action at Citizens Bank Park. Philadelphia pitcher and Long Beach, California, native Ricky Tiedemann had an outstanding performance. Tiedemann got the win, improving to 2-6. He gave up 2 hits and walked 4 over 5 innings. He allowed 2 runs. After today's action, Philadelphia sits at 25-34, while Seattle falls to 33-26.
Bo Naylor had a big bases-clearing double for the Phalanx in the bottom of the third inning. With Philadelphia leading 3-0 and the bases loaded, he got a fastball from fireballing right-hander Jose Soriano and swatted a double to center. It was his 5th double of the season, and more importantly, it put the Phalanx ahead, 6-0.
"It was a solid team effort," said Tiedemann after the game.
